#7f7d68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7f7d68 is composed of 49.8% red, 49%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.6% magenta, 18.1%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 54.8 degrees, a saturation of 10% and a lightness of 45.3%. #7f7d68 color hex could be obtained by blending #fefad0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#7f7d68 color description : Dark grayish yellow.
#7f7d68 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7f7d68 has RGB values of R:127, G:125,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.18,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 8355176.

Shades and Tints of #7f7d68
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080807 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fd is the lightest one.
